#77614e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#77614e is composed of 46.7% red, 38%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 18.5% magenta, 34.5% yellow and 53.3% black. It has a hue angle of 27.8 degrees, a saturation of 20.8% and a lightness of 38.6%. #77614e color hex could be obtained by blending #eec29c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

Shades and Tints of #77614e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010000 is the darkest color, while #f8f5f4 is the lightest one.
